THE ROLE

Reporting to the Director, Identity Access Management (IAM) – IAM is responsible for building and maintaining the corporate systems that manage user access to the network, systems, and services.
We are looking for an experience software developer to lead and contribute the development of our IAM code base. The team is a mixture of both APS staff and contractors.
You will work with high performing individuals in a team that is trusted by leadership to deliver a modern IAM system based on the latest cloud technology.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Responsibilities of the senior software developer may include:

  • Lead the development of code base for the departments IAM capability.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to produce software design and architecture patterns.
  • Ensure documentation correctly reflects the current design.
  • Implement code changes as per the design, ensuring quality is maintained.
  • Ensure testers can fully test all existing and future features.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to develop agreed integration APIs.
  • Mentor / coach other developers in good coding practices.
  • Assist in managing delivery of the IAM system.
  • Assist with effort estimate, costings and tracking of work deliverables.
  • Representing the team in various meetings and forums.
